Bake the Best Barm Brack: A Delight for Your Taste

Recipe Details

Servings:
10
Yield:
1 to 8 – inch round cake

Ingredients

  • 1 ½cupsbrewed black tea, cold

  • 1cuppacked light brown sugar

  • 1 ¼cupsgolden raisins

  • ¼cupchopped candied citron

  • 1 ¼cupsself-rising flour

  • 1egg, beaten

Cooking Directions

  1. Put the tea, sugar, raisins and peel into a bowl, cover and leave to soak overnight.

  2.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our an 8 inch round pan.

  3. Sift the flour into the fruit mixture, add the egg and beat well.

  4. Pour into the cake pan and b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 1 hour and 45 minutes, or until toothpick inserted into center of cake comes out clean. Leave in the pan for 5 minutes, then turn out onto a wire rack.
